Fracturing or Peeling Off Surface Areas



When the paint on your home's exterior begins to exhibit fracturing or peeling off surface areas, it indicates a demand for focus and maintenance to support the building's visual charm. Breaking takes place when the paint film splits open, commonly resembling a dried-up riverbed, while peeling happens when the paint loses its bond to the surface under it.

These concerns not just detract from the visual appeals of your home but likewise jeopardize the defense the paint provides against the components.

Cracking and peeling off surface areas can be triggered by numerous aspects such as bad surface area preparation prior to paint, use of low-grade paint, exposure to severe weather conditions, or just the natural aging of the paint. Neglecting these indications can bring about further damage to the hidden surfaces, potentially resulting in more considerable and expensive repairs in the future.

To resolve cracking or peeling off surface areas, it is crucial to scrape off the loose paint, sand the area, use a primer, and repaint the afflicted areas. By taking timely action to rectify these concerns, you can keep your home's exterior appeal and guard it from possible deterioration.

Timber Rot or Water Damages



Discovery of timber rot or water damages on your home's surface areas requires prompt interest to avoid additional architectural damage and maintain the honesty of the residential property. Wood rot, an outcome of long term exposure to moisture, can deteriorate the structure of your home, compromising its security. Common signs of timber rot include soft or spongy areas, discoloration, or a mildewy odor.
